About the Role

We are recruiting for a Retrofit Coordinator to manage retrofit projects from inception to completion, ensuring full compliance with PAS 2035 standards. This role requires acting in the best interests of clients - including occupants, landlords, and funding organisations - as well as the wider public.

You will be responsible for overseeing the delivery of retrofit projects, coordinating activities, managing risks, and ensuring projects meet all required quality and compliance standards.

Key Responsibilities
  • Agree intended project outcomes with clients and revisit these where necessary.

  • Conduct project risk assessments to determine PAS 2035 pathways.

  • Oversee Whole-Dwelling Assessments conducted by qualified Retrofit Assessors.

  • Produce Improvement Option Evaluations to identify suitable measures.

  • Develop Medium-Term Improvement Plans for individual properties or property types.

  • Confirm agreed measures for immediate installation with clients.

  • Collaborate with Retrofit Designers to ensure designs are fully informed and compliant.

  • Monitor the design, specification, and installation of retrofit measures.

  • Oversee testing, completion, and handover processes.

  • Ensure that residents and landlords receive energy advice at key project stages.

  • Conduct project evaluations and provide feedback to clients and delivery teams.

  • Compile and submit compliance evidence in line with PAS 2035 requirements.

  • Perform additional monitoring where project outcomes have not met expectations.
